Foucault Michel - Wrong - Doing Truth - Telling The Function Of Avowal In Justice - Paperback Jurisprudence & Philosophy Of Law This item's title is: VictimsBinding: Paperback Description: Three years before his death Michel Foucault delivered a series of lectures at the Catholic University of Louvain that until recently remained almost unknown. These lectures which focus on the role of avowal or confession in the determination of truth and justice provide the missing link between Foucault's early work on madness delinquency and sexuality and his later explorations of subjectivity in Greek and Roman
